Lean-Agile Smart Transformation is a systemic transformation service designed for manufacturers seeking fundamental improvements in how their operations are structured, engineered, managed, and continuously evolved.
Rather than addressing isolated problems or implementing standalone Lean tools, the service examines manufacturing as an interconnected operating system. It identifies systemic performance gaps and redesigns the critical structures, systems, processes, capabilities, and management practices required to improve flow, productivity, agility, quality, cost, and responsiveness.
Grounded in the SmartLean Agility™ doctrine, transformation is tailored to each manufacturer's strategic priorities, operating realities, and competitive objectives.
Transformation Scope
The engagement can encompass:
- Manufacturing Competitiveness Assessment — identifying systemic gaps, hidden losses, constraints, and improvement opportunities.
- Strategic Transformation Roadmap — defining priorities, transformation architecture, initiatives, and implementation sequencing.
- Manufacturing Systems Engineering — redesigning factory flow, operating systems, resource structures, and execution practices.
- Lean-Agile Operations — improving flow, efficiency, flexibility, responsiveness, and order-change adaptability.
- Manufacturing Intelligence — strengthening performance visibility, analytics, decision-making, and improvement management.
- Organization & Workforce Capability — developing the management, engineering, supervisory, and workforce capabilities required to sustain transformation.
- Implementation & Continuous Evolution — converting identified opportunities into implemented systems, measurable gains, and sustained competitive performance.
